Transaction 831ddf656768781d1eb202642a7b381aef75838acc011ef83443e9a4e9a13495
1 Input
1 Output
-
831ddf656768781d1eb202642a7b381aef75838acc011ef83443e9a4e9a13495:0
- value
- 634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a59533a78fb4d9750690f2d9e4b502a5907026d1 OP_EQUAL
- address
- 3GnY9v8dYaeyJqqKZwxkqctALakdAfdF5Y